Output efb93e33a9d2242d325da3d0f35d4a6e44dc339bbf52648eca22a3318d7fb4f7:0

value
380000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5968fc8b9a957023452fee98fb3d59d0a4f563ea OP_EQUALVERIFY OP_CHECKSIG
address
199kufTuWBMqScdNpfQfry6xg7JmabGSw7
transaction
efb93e33a9d2242d325da3d0f35d4a6e44dc339bbf52648eca22a3318d7fb4f7
spent
true